Rocket-CDS / RocketDirectoryAPI

GNU General Public License v3.0
0 stars 0 forks source link

Query Params difficult to understand #7

Open leedavi opened 1 month ago

leedavi commented 1 month ago

The dependency query strings are difficult to understand.

https://docs.rocket-cds.org/integration/dependancies

They are linked to the AppTheme, but you need to go into the Rocket Tools "Menu, Query Params, Style Helper" to activate them and edit them.

This works, but is confusing if they do not work on first entery.

leedavi commented 1 month ago

queryparm also needs to be different for each system. Can this be avoided? Not sure it can, we will not know which system to do the selection on if there are multiple modules on the page. Some error warning needs to happen if we get duplicates.

DNNrocketUtils.GetQueryKeys(int portalId)

OK, this has been updated to use both querykey + systemkey for the dictionary key.

leedavi commented 1 month ago

Better documentation is the easiest way to solve this.